Guards have poor vita pools that won’t come close to necro, but they have good toughness and plenty of condi clears. Loose some zerker and add valk, take the radiance traitline and go with 1 handed to compensate; i usualy keep about 20% crit. You don’t need pure zerker to be effective on guard. Going that route also opens up more burn options as well that synerze with a solid clear like purging flames….

Mobility is the second problem. By going one handed, you get sword tele and the radiance buffs judjes intervention (i like more tele). Nothing is going to beat wings (f2) if you go dragon hunter though.

I personaly run radiance 2-2-1/ zeal 3-3-3 as my typical build and the 3rd is situational. valk/zerk armor, carrion weapons and sinister trinks for a nice hybrid. Its a bit eclectic, but the stats are comfortable.

This is my approach, there are others. Biggest thing is buff the vita pool and get mobility where you can… if you don’t like the one above or that concept, try a symbol build and hammer for perma protection and healing symbols.

You can go power and use radiance actually that’s good; I do zeal/radiance too as above – but GS focus w/ zeal. You can go Honor/Valor for more defensive options; and DH of course helps – as said vit is seriously lacking on Guard BUT – you have aegis/blocks and protection/stability and ways to mitigate dmg. Also, it’s Open World – shield, focus are great to pair with sword for more defensive options or hammer as said – while still doing great DPS plus swap with GS or sword/torch or etc. for the pure DPS weaps.

I mix zerk/soldier or mara gear open world. Also, I use Traveler’s Runes – the 25% movement speed plus u get boon/condi dur it’s decent; I wouldn’t use it for fractals/dungeons/raids. Also I use Retreat! when moving; w/ boon dur from runes mobility is not a factor; plus u can use it for a block. However it isn’t useful in story fights, etc. not compared to other abilities this is for moving/etc.

It takes getting used to once you do tho tbh it’s hard to die as Guardian.

Bererker all the way and traveler runes. Slot Valor for meditations and then Zeal/Radiance (or DH) for damage. Run whatever weapons you want.

Medis will keep you alive, traveler runes keep you pretty kitten mobile. Does a ton of damage.

Stay full zerker and just get better at staying alive. You’ll need the practice for higher fractals and raids if you plan to do those. I’m full glass cannon and only get downed a couple times in a long play session, usually when trying to train through a bunch of crap that chain CCs me.

I pretty much only do open world metas and solo stuff, so this is what I’ve been using since the latest balance patch:

The big thing here is keeping Retaliation and Fury up for when you use GS#2 and Procession of Blades. With Retaliation and Fury, you have a 100% crit chance, which turns GS#2 and Procession of Blades into murder machines.

Flame Legion runes because it can be difficult sometimes to maintain 90%+ for Scholar runes, Force sigils because it’s the best, and Strength sigils because I found Air to be kinda mediocre for open world since you’re usually pulling 2-3+ mobs at a given time. Maybe Fire is better, I’m not sure yet.

Since you can easily dump precision, you can replace Berserker gear for some Valkyrie gear to gain a significant health boost. I’m currently sitting at just over 20k, which is much better than the paltry 12k or so health a Guardian gets.
